Fly Pest Control in Arlington, TX
Fly pest control services focus on eliminating and preventing fly infestations around residential properties. This service typically covers projects such as treating indoor and outdoor areas where flies congregate, including kitchens, trash areas, patios, and gardens. Property owners often seek fly control when experiencing persistent fly presence that can be disruptive or unsanitary, especially during warmer months or after outdoor gatherings. Understanding the extent of the fly problem, the specific areas affected, and any underlying causes like trash buildup or standing water can help homeowners make informed decisions about the service needed.
Before requesting fly pest control, property owners usually want to know about the methods used to reduce fly populations and prevent future issues. It’s helpful to identify common attractants around the property, such as uncovered trash cans or decaying organic matter, and to consider any ongoing conditions that might encourage fly activity. Clarifying expectations regarding treatment areas and maintenance measures can ensure the service effectively addresses the problem and minimizes future fly issues around the home.

Fly Pest Control Questions
What types of flies are commonly treated? Fly pest control typically targets common household flies, cluster flies, fruit flies, and drain flies that invade residential and commercial properties.
How do fly control services work? Treatments often involve targeted applications to eliminate existing flies and prevent future infestations through sanitation advice and barrier methods.
Are fly treatments safe for pets and children? Yes, approved treatments are designed to be safe for homes with pets and children when applied by professionals following safety guidelines.
What areas can benefit from fly pest control? Fly control services are effective for kitchens, dining areas, trash zones, and any space prone to fly activity inside or outside a property.
